早就入手pi,但是好的高清线+转接线太贵了,烂的又不想买,所以当时没有买那东西,所以我的pi一直扔在那里没玩过,无意间知道pi可以通过串口登陆,手头正好有USB转TTL(以下简称TTL)和足够的杜邦线,所以就倒腾起来,说明一下,我手头有刷好系统的sd卡,系统用的是官方推荐(wheez)的那个。
首先要明白串口通信只要两根线TX和RX,而且在实际连接时TX和RX要交叉相接,也就是pi的TX接TTL的RX,pi的RX接TTL的TX;弄明白了串口通信原理现在来看下连线,pi的GPIO定义如下图(这个是pi2的定义),不难找出14、15脚就是TX和RX,连接之;
pc上我使用的是putty作为串口调试软件,putty就不详细介绍了,有兴趣的自行百度,这里主要说明一下串口的用法。putty程序界面如下图:
点击红色圈出的serial出现下图:
这里只修改两个地方,首先传输速率Speed改为115200,然后看TTl在你电脑上实际是哪个com口,查看方法:将鼠标放到我的电脑右键,选管理,选设备管理器,点开端口就可以看到对应的com口,当然前提是你要将TTL插在电脑上;放一张改好的图,我的是com4口,设置完成后点击最上面的Session。
然后选择连接方式(connection type)里面的serial选项,剩下的就等open了, 当然在open前也可以将设置保存一下,以便下一次使用时可以方便的使用,个人建议最好保存一下,因为每次登陆都要重新配置是个很令人讨厌的事情。
最后一次检查所有的连线是否正确,确保TTL已经插在电脑上,然后给pi上电,点击putty的open按钮(顺序无所谓的),然后你会看到pi启动滚屏的画面,等一会就停在登陆界面:
输入 用户名:pi 密码:raspberry,就进入pi,
然后注意倒数第四行那个大写的NOTICE,大意就是让你输入命令sudo raspi-confing来完成配置,具体配置和在有屏幕时配置一样,请参考之,这里不详细讲了,放一张图作为参考:
总结:本来以为pi只有通过显示器才能配置,网上找到的资料也只是大概提了一下可以用ttl方式来配置,但是没有具体的给出图文教程,所以就大胆的尝试了一下,没想到成功了,貌似用这种方式来配置pi能节省不少money,当然前提是你不怎么用显示器;还有命令sudo raspi-confing是可以随时进入设置界面,随时修改密码进行超频什么的,感觉好方便;网上说还可以用ssh来完成配置的,我手头没有路由,不知道能不能行;不论如何,总算将闲置已久的pi利用上了,下来正是好好倒腾去鸟~
|